Novum testamentum illustratum insignium rerum simulachris. No place [Paris], François Gryphe, 1541. 2 parts in one volume.
16mo (114x70 mm.). Title with printer's device in woodcut. Illustrated with numerous half-page woodcuts. Lacking 2 blank leaves (Aa8 and T8).
20th century vellum, gilt title to spine, gilt edges, marbled inner doblures and endpapers, slight wear. Small bookplate of Paul Harth on first free endpaper.
First published in 1539 by Gryphe and later re-issued in 1540, 1541 and 1542.
Woodcut illustrations probably after Hans Sebald Beham.
